The Maral Ensemble In Istanbul Turned 40 Years Old

Over 2019, the Istanbul Song and Dance Ensemble Maral has been preparing for the festive concert dedicated to the 40th anniversary of its founding which was held at the Istanbul Congress Center in on December 15, 2019.

The Maral Song and Dance Ensemble was founded in 1980 by Benoit Kuzubashi and his friends. The main goal of the ensemble has since been to present Armenian culture, dance, songs, and music.

Since 1992, the former dancers of the ensemble Maral, now spouses Karpis and Iris Chapkan, took up the position of dance instructors. Currently, the ensemble Maral involves dancers from 6 to 35 years old in a group of 200 dancers.
